Discover the Main Solutions Provided at Ultimate Car Detailing
What essential packages define exceptional car detailing? At the center of ultimate car detailing are several critical services engineered to rejuvenate and enhance a vehicle's appearance. First, detailed exterior washing removes dirt and grime, followed by a clay bar treatment to eliminate embedded contaminants. Next, paint correction may be undertaken to address imperfections, guaranteeing a flawless shine.
Interior detailing encompasses deep cleaning of carpet fibers, upholstery, and solid materials, frequently employing steam-based cleaning and professional-grade solutions. Additionally, tire and wheel cleaning, along with application of protective coatings, assist in preserving a car's outside surfaces.
One significant factor is protective sealant application, which gives a protective shield against natural elements. Finally, engine compartment cleaning can improve overall aesthetics and performance. Collectively, these procedures promise that a car not only looks pristine but also sustains its valuation over time.
How Regularly Do You Need to Arrange Car Detailing?
How regularly should one schedule car polishing? The best frequency depends on various factors, including the vehicle's operation, environment, and individual preferences. For individuals who commute daily or face harsh conditions—such as inclement weather or dust-prone environments—detailing services are recommended every three to six months. This routine maintenance helps preserve the car's interior and exterior, mitigating long-term damage.
Conversely, for those who use their vehicles occasionally or maintain them meticulously, detailing may only be necessary once or twice annually.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ning and vacuuming, can extend the intervals between professional detailing sessions. Ultimately, the decision should take into account the vehicle's condition and the owner's commitment to maintaining its appearance. Scheduling car detailing periodically ensures that the vehicle remains in peak condition, improving both its look and market value.

Everyday Cleaning Routine
Keeping a steady washing routine can significantly prolong the life of a vehicle's finish, guaranteeing it stays vibrant and attractive. Regular washing cleans off dirt, grime, and contaminants that cause wear over time. Ideally, washing should be done every two weeks, though how often may depend on environmental conditions. Using a high-grade car shampoo and a soft sponge can prevent scratches, while rinsing thoroughly prevents soap residue. It’s vital to watch wheels and undercarriage, as these parts collect significant dirt. Washing in the shade can also stop water spots from forming. By following this routine, car owners can protect their vehicle’s finish and improve its overall aesthetic appeal, keeping it looking newer longer.
Preserve With Wax
Maintaining a vehicle's look goes beyond routine cleaning; applying wax is an essential step in protecting its surface. Wax acts as a shield against external factors such as UV rays, road salt, and contaminants, preventing them from damaging the paint. A well-applied coat of wax improves the car's luster while providing a hydrophobic layer that repels water, making future cleaning easier. To maximize the benefits, it is suggested to wax the vehicle every three months, ensuring that the protective coating remains intact. When selecting a wax, picking premium products can help achieve a longer-lasting shine. Additionally, applying wax in a shadowed location and using proper techniques can result in a perfect finish, preserving the car's visual beauty between professional detailing services.

Will detailing get rid of marks on My Car's paint?
Detailing can minimize the look of scratches on a car's paint, especially through polishing techniques. However, more profound scratches may need specialized treatments or repainting for complete removal, depending on their severity and depth.
How much time Does a Full Detailing Service Usually Take?
A comprehensive detailing service usually takes four to six hours approximately, relying upon the vehicle's condition and size. Considerations such as requested services and the detailer's expertise also influence the duration overall.
